Sidhi is a village situated in Jaisinghnagar tehsil of Shahdol district in Madhya Pradesh. As per the Population Census 2011, there are a total of 461 families residing in the village Sidhi. The total population of Sidhi is 1,827 out of which 937 are males and 890 are females thus the Average Sex Ratio of Sidhi is 950.

The population of Children aged 0-6 years in Sidhi village is 265 which is 15% of the total population. There are 136 male children and 129 female children between the age 0-6 years. Thus as per the Census 2011 the Child Sex Ratio of Sidhi is 949 which is less than Average Sex Ratio (950) of Sidhi village.

As per the Census 2011, the literacy rate of Sidhi is 74%. Thus Sidhi village has a higher literacy rate compared to 56.7% of Shahdol district. The male literacy rate is 84.64% and the female literacy rate is 62.81% in Sidhi village.

Caste Data as per Census 2011

Schedule Caste (SC) constitutes 14.3% while Schedule Tribe (ST) were 50.6% of total population in Sidhi village.


Working Population as per Census 2011

In Sidhi village out of total population, 994 were engaged in work activities. 22.6% of workers describe their work as Main Work (Employment or Earning more than 6 Months) while 77.4% were involved in Marginal activity providing livelihood for less than 6 months. Of 994 workers engaged in Main Work, 53 were cultivators (owner or co-owner) while 21 were Agricultural labourers.
